Ladies and gentlemen. This fight is 3 rounds, in the bantamweight division.
Introducing the fighter to my left, fighting out of the red corner.
With a record of 0 - 0 - 0, fighting out of The Island, Mick Haggar!
And introducing the fighter to my right, fighting out of the blue corner.
With a record of 0 - 0 - 0, fighting out of The Island, Nicos Diassen!
The judges for this bout are , and .




The bell rings for round one and we are underway!
Diassen missing with a left hand there. Haggar was out of range so wasted energy throwing that one.
Diassen lands an overhand left. A wild punch that just about connected.
Haggar uses good head movement to avoid the hook from Diassen.
Haggar moves out of range as Diassen strikes.
Haggar misses with a wild body shot.
Diassen throws an overhand right that lands on Haggar's shoulder, as Haggar tries to avoid the shot.

Haggar shoots in from a long way out. He's driving through with the takedown attempt and he eventually gets it, landing in Diassen's guard.
We could do with one of the fighters taking the initiative a bit more on the ground - they're both waiting to capitalize on a mistake.
Haggar landing with the ground and pound.
Haggar with a couple of shots to the head there. Not particularly brutal.

Haggar got a little sloppy there for a moment and Diassen has worked his way into a loose triangle - can he finish it?! No, Haggar has managed to get both his arms back between Diassen's legs - danger averted.

Diassen working from the bottom, still in full guard. He's managed to get a loose triangle. Haggar doesn't seem to be doing much to defend here, obviously he feels comfortable in the position. Haggar manages to throw the legs off his shoulder and he's back into guard - no problem.
Diassen working a defensive guard here.

That's one minute gone in the round.
Haggar stopping the sweep attempt from Diassen.

Diassen is working actively off his back, looking to secure an arm or perhaps work for a triangle.
Haggar showing good wrestling skills to control the position.
Diassen is looking to sweep but instead, Haggar has passed into half guard.
Diassen trying to hold on to Haggar's head to control him but Haggar postures up.

That's two minutes gone in the round.
Diassen is looking to improve his position.
Haggar content to control rather than advance.
Diassen is trying to get back to full guard.
Haggar lands with a punch from half guard.

That's three minutes gone in the round.

Haggar postures up and decides to stand up, from the half guard. The ref calls for Diassen to stand up.

Haggar feints and then dives in with a takedown. That was a long way out but the feint bought him enough time to close the distance and complete the takedown. Now we'll play guard for a bit and see who can get the better of that position.

Haggar is trying to tuck his arms in to keep them safe but Diassen has managed to isolate one of them and has got a loose triangle. Haggar is looking to defend but Diassen has done well to lock his legs together - this could be big trouble for Haggar! Diassen pulls down on the head and a little smile comes across his face - he knows he's got it. Yep, Haggar taps out and this one is all over!

Ladies and gentlemen, after 3:30 of round 1, we have a winner by way of Submission (Triangle). Nicos Diassen!
